Monitor and verify clients Authorize only - … WebSep 8, 2024 · Therefore, merchants need to understand what chargebacks are and how to prevent them. What is a chargeback? A chargeback is a debit or credit card transaction that an issuing bank forcibly returns from a merchant’s bank account to a cardholder’s account after the latter disputes the charge. WebApr 13, 2024 · The Federal Trade Commission and the State of Florida have filed suit against Chargebacks911 for unfairly thwarting consumers who were trying to dispute credit card charges through the chargeback process. In a complaint filed in federal court, the FTC and Florida charged that, since at least 2016, the “chargeback mitigation” company and its … WebMay 14, 2024 · Card networks, card processors and acquiring banks have myriad tools available for merchants to help prevent chargebacks, and merchants “should make sure they are leveraging all of the fraud prevention services provided by their acquirer and network,” says Scott DeBoard, vice president of the Discover Global Network. Web1) Address guest dissatisfaction immediately. 4% of chargebacks occur because the product did not meet a guest's expectations. If you notice an unhappy guest or receive a complaint, open up the lines of communication and try to quickly resolve the issue before a diner gets to their card statement to deny a transaction. WebChargeback Protection uses Stripe Radar’s machine learning to block fraud and prevent disputes. We combine behavioral information and the power of the Stripe network to make real-time risk assessments and optimize checkout flows.
